WebAug 13, 2024 · To configure this, tap “App Limits” on the Screen Time page and then tap “Add Limit.”. Choose one or more categories of apps and then tap the “Add” button. You can also select “All Apps & Categories” here if you’d like to limit your time in all apps on your phone or tablet instead of specific types of apps.
